Thumbs up MOMO shift knob on TSX

I will post pics of my MOMO Evo Carbon Fiber/Leather Shift knob installed on my TSX. No Digital Cam

But No, the MOMO shift knob you want will not fit because its originally for Manual Transmission. (if you have manual then, )

I was able to fit a M/T MOMO shift knob on my A/T TSX.

The diameter of the metal rod from the A/T on the TSX after you screw off the original OEM knob is 0.25 inches.

Because the MOMO shift knob package only includes a small rubber cap that is not long enough to fill in the cavity of the new Shift knob, I had to improvise and get a rubber tube that filled the whole cavity of the new MOMO shift knob that would first fit inside the MOMO shfit knob cavity and then once the rubber tube was in place, it had to then fit on the metal TSX rod.

My MOMO shift knob required this rubber tube I fit inside:

Outside Diameter: 0.5 inches
Inside Diameter: 0.25 inches ( this should be same for you, because we both have TSX , mine is 2005 by the way)

The trick is to find rubber tubing that has the outside diameter that will fit inside your new MOMO knob and also have the inside diameter of 0.25 inches for the metal TSX rod. And hard enough rubber tubing that can have the 3 Hex screws, dont get rubber tubing like the thin catheter like tubes used in hospitals.

It was a B*tch trying to find rubber tubing with those O.D and I.D ! But after cutting the rubber tube, and fitting inside the new knob and then fitting on the rod, and then screwing in the 3 hex screws, Wa la!

All this could be prevented if MOMO included a rubber tube long enough rather than that small rubber cap! but then they did say it was for Manual Transmission.
